urlparse模組(專門用來解析URL格式)

2022-03-12 21:46:29 字數 1610 閱讀 8690

#

-*- coding: utf-8 -*-

#python 27

#xiaodeng

#urlparse模組(專門用來解析url格式)

#url格式:

#protocol ://hostname[:port] / path / [;parameters][?query]#fragment

#parameters:特殊引數,一般用的很少。

#1、urlparse方法

#將url解析為6元組,返回乙個parseresult物件元組。

#2、urlsplit方法

#返回乙個splitresult物件。如果url中沒有[;parameters],建議使用urlsplit,更明確,更簡潔。

#3、獲取url屬性值等方法

#4、urljoin,進行合併url操作,給faq.html新增基礎url位址

print urlparse.urljoin('

', '

faq.html')

#''#5、例項:

urlparse模組(python模組)

一 urlparse模組簡介 urlparse模組主要是把url拆分為6部分,並返回元組。並且可以把拆分後的部分再組成乙個url。主要有函式有urljoin urlsplit urlunsplit urlparse等。二 urljoin函式使用 urljoin主要是拼接url,它以base作為其基位...

urlparse模組和json模組詳解

urlparse urlparse主要是url的分解和拼接,分析出url中的各項引數,其主要的函式如下 urlparse 主要將url分解成6個片段,返回乙個包括6個片段的物件 import urlparse url urlparse.urlparse print url 結果 字典 query1 ...

python 中 urlparse 模組介紹

urlparse模組主要是用於解析url中的引數 對url按照一定格式進行 拆分或拼接 1.urlparse.urlparse 將url分為6個部分,返回乙個包含6個字串專案的元組 協議 位置 路徑 引數 查詢 片段。import urlparse url change urlparse.urlpa...